Trans Bavaria

Deutschland 2011 Spielfilm

Summary

The language of revolution is Bavarian: Since he can remember , 19-year-old Quirinalis has been frustrated by the fact that he has not the biographical background befitting a rebel, but instead is the son of two liberal teachers and was born and raised in Southern Bavaria. Nevertheless, having just finished school with excellent grades, he sets out to become a revolutionary. Joined by his friends Joker and Wursti, he nicks a delivery van and begins his personal quest. Their destination is Moscow, where Quirinalis hopes to get first-hand information on the job of a revolutionary from Fidel Castro himself.
